Audition Call for GALA Community
Theater’s Summer Production

Gulf Alliance for Local Arts (GALA) announced that on April 27th auditions will be held for its 2010 Summer Production of Sex Please We’re Sixty!, an American farce written by Michael and Susan Parker and directed by Margy Oehlert. The three performances are scheduled for July 9th, 10th and 11th, 2010.
The farce takes place at Mrs. Stancliffe’s Rose Cottage Bed & Breakfast, a successful B&B for many years. Her guests (nearly all women) return year after year. Her next door neighbor, the elderly, silver-tongued, Bud “Bud the Stud” Davis believes they come to spend time with him in romantic liaisons. The prim and proper Mrs. Stancliffe steadfastly denies this, but really doesn’t do anything to prevent it. She reluctantly accepts the fact that “Bud the Stud” is, in fact, good for business. Her other neighbor and would-be suitor Henry Mitchell is a retired chemist who has developed a blue pill called “Venusia,” after Venus the goddess of love, to increase the libido of menopausal women. The pill has not been tested. Add to the guest list three older women: Victoria Ambrose, a romance novelist whose personal life seems to be lacking in romance; Hillary Hudson a friend of Henry’s who has agreed to test the Venusia: and Charmaine Beauregard, a “Southern Belle” whose libido does not need to be increased! Bud gets his hands on some of the Venusia pills and the fun begins, as he attempts to entertain all three women! The women mix up Bud’s Viagra pills with the Venusia, and we soon discover that it has a strange effect on men: it gives them all the symptoms of menopausal women, complete with hot flashes, mood swings, weeping and irritability! When the mayhem settles down, all the women find their lives moving in new and surprising directions.
“When the director first approached us with just the title, I must admit a few eyebrows were raised,” stated Blake Denton, GALA Community Theater Chairperson. “But after reading it and its reviews from across the country, we realized it was not inappropriate as the title may suggest,” continues Denton.
There are 6 roles to be cast, 4 women and 2 men all age 50+. There are also crew positions available as well for those who wish to participate but not be on stage. It will be open audition. Those wanting to audition or seek crew positions simply have to show up that day to do so. Auditions will take place Tuesday, April 27, 2010, 7:00 p.m. EST at the Cape San Blas Firehouse. The firehouse is located off C-30, just after you turn on the Cape Road.
